Community Action VITA Program Now Preparing Amended, Prior Year and Current Year Tax Returns for Low-Income Residents

For Immediate Release: Monday, July 10, 2017

The Community Action Agency’s Volunteer Income Tax Assistance (VITA) partnership, part of the Department of Health and Human Services, is now scheduling appointments through October 31 for amended, prior year and current year tax returns. VITA’s free tax preparation services are exclusively for Montgomery County residents. To qualify, residents must have incomes of less than $54,000.

Through the VITA program, residents can apply for or renew an Individual Taxpayer Identification Number (ITIN).  Per the Internal Revenue Service (IRS), ITINs not used on a federal income tax return at least once in the past three years will expire December 31, 2017.  Affected taxpayers who expect to file a tax return in 2018 must submit a renewal application.  For more information, visit the ITIN website at https://www.irs.gov/individuals/individual-taxpayer-identification-number-itin .

 

Since 2008, Community Action has provided the only free, year-round tax preparation program in Montgomery County.  In tax year 2016, the VITA program filed tax returns for 2,204 county households, totaling more than $5.4 million in refunds and credits to taxpayers.
